Restriction Orifice Plate Manufacturer in India
   A Restriction Orifice Plate (ROP) is a precision-engineered flow restriction device used to create a permanent pressure drop in a pipeline system. Installed between pipe flanges, the plate contains a specially machined bore that controls fluid velocity and reduces downstream pressure. These plates are widely used in liquid, gas, steam, and chemical processing systems where controlled flow restriction and energy dissipation are essential.

Working Principle
Â
      A Restriction Orifice Plate works on the principle of differential pressure and ​When fluid passes through the reduced opening of the orifice plate, the velocity of the fluid increases while the pressure decreases.Â
This controlled pressure drop restricts the flow and reduces downstream pressure to a desired level. In high-pressure applications, multi-stage restriction orifice assemblies are often used to distribute pressure reduction gradually and minimize:
- Cavitation
- Flashing
- Excessive noise
- Vibration
- Pipe erosion
     Proper sizing is critical because restriction orifices often operate under severe flow conditions involving large pressure reductions and possible sonic flow or choked flow conditions.

Technical Specifications
Restriction Orifice Plate Types We Manufacture
Single Stage Restriction Orifice Plate
Used for moderate pressure drop applications where cavitation and noise are minimal.
Multi-Stage Restriction Orifice Assembly
Multiple plates installed in series for large pressure reduction applications.
Multi-Hole Restriction Orifice Plate
Designed to reduce turbulence, noise, and vibration while improving flow distribution.
Concentric Restriction Orifice Plate
Most common design for clean liquid and gas applications.
Custom Engineered Restriction Orifice
Manufactured according to customer process conditions and piping specifications.

What is the difference between an Orifice Plate and a Restriction Orifice Plate?
A standard Orifice Plate is mainly used for flow measurement, while a Restriction Orifice Plate is designed primarily for pressure reduction and flow restriction.
